摘要

It is very important to character the logging curves' response of coal bed methane (CBM) reservoir and analyze their correspondent mechanisms because it's the foundation of CBM reservoir recognizing and evaluation. 185 CBM rock samples were tested, and the data such as proximate analysis, maceral, clay minerals as well as the vitrinite reflectance (Ro) were tested, then by using the mathematic statistical, the geophysical logging mechanism of coal bed methane reservoir were discussed with the analysis of in-situ geophysical logging data, and finally yielded the characters of proximate analysis and geophysical logging in the high rank CBM.
